- Sales of
$6.1 billion , up 2.1% year-on-year with organic sales up 0.6% year-on-year. - Adjusted sales of
$6.0 billion , up 3.7% year-on-year with adjusted organic sales up 2.2% year-on-year. - 3M returned
$0.9 billion to shareholders via dividends and share repurchases. - Cash from operations of
$1.6 billion . - Adjusted free cash flow of
$1.3 billion .

- Sales of
$24.9 billion , up 1.5% year-on-year with organic sales up 0.9% year-on-year. - Adjusted sales of
$24.3 billion , up 2.7% year-on-year with adjusted organic sales up 2.1% year-on-year. - 3M returned
$4.8 billion to shareholders via dividends and share repurchases. - Cash from operations of
$2.3 billion . - Adjusted free cash flow of
$4.4 billion .

Full-year 2026 guidance
3M provided the following full-year 2026 expectations.
- Adjusted total sales growth1 of ~4 percent, reflecting adjusted organic sales growth1 of ~3 percent.
- Adjusted operating income margin expansion1 of 70 bps to 80 bps.
- Adjusted EPS1 in the range of
$8.50 to$8.70 . - Adjusted operating cash flow1 of
$5.6 to$5.8 billion , contributing to >100 percent adjusted free cash flow conversion1.
